The measurement of an unknown resistance R is to be carried out using Wheatstone bridge as given in the figure below. Twostudents perform an experiment in two ways. The first students takes R_(2) = 10 Omega and R_(1) = 5 Omega. The other student takes R_(2) = 1000 Omega and R_(1) = 500 Omega. In the standard arm, both take R_(3) = 5 Omega . bothfind R= (R_(2))/(R_(1)) , R_(3) = 10 Omega within errors. |
|
Answer» The errors of measurement of the two students are the same. For balanced condition of Wheatstone bridge, `(R_(2))/(R) = (R_(1))/(R_(3)) ` `therefore R = R_(3) xx (R_(2))/(R_(1))` For first student :`R_(1)= 5 Omega , R_(2) = 10 Omega` and `R_(3) = 5 Omega` `therefore R = 5 xx (10)/(5)= 10 Omega` For SECOND student : `R_(1) = 500 Omega , R_(2) = 1000 Omega`, `"" R_(3) = 5 Omega` `therefore R = 5 xx (1000)/(500) = 10 Omega` If` R_(1) and R_(2)` are chosen in such a way that it is of very large then current flowing through galvanometer will be very small HENCE null point can be obtained accurately. |
